Photoelectrocatalytic decolorization of methylene blue using reduced graphene oxide modified TiO2 on filter paper
In this work, titanium dioxide (TiO2) was modified with reduced graphene oxide (rGO), and then coated on filter paper to prepare the rGT/FP photoelectrode for the photoelectrocatalytic (PEC) decolorization of methylene blue (MB).
